I'm new to Audi and I've recently bought an 2004 1.9 TDI A3. I'm looking at getting it remapped, however is there anything anybody can recommend getting before I do so, for example a bigger fuel pump maybe.
 
On a 1.9tdi you'd need a hybrid turbo and other bits and bats before you went near the limit of the fuel pump.

A good stage one map should see you to around 135ish from 105.
 
Ok brilliant thanks Sayam, how about after that? What would you recommend doing once I've had the remap?
 
As Sayam said, to go beyond stage 1 you'd need a hybrid turbo... But you can get a turboback exhaust or downpipe, egr delete to reduce carbon build up and help with smoother running... But it'd be worth having a friendly MOT guy lol
